Check out the newest feature on our Museum's website:
   Quicktime Virtual Reality, 360 degree panorama's of certain exhibits,
   starting with our new Lord Admiral Nelson Gallery (
http://www.mariner.org/exhibits/nelson/ )

In addition, our permanent August Crabtree Gallery of Miniature Ships is
unbelievable, with the models appearing to be suspended in mid-air (
http://www.mariner.org/images/qtvr/ct.html )

I would look forward to other Museum's experience with such technology
online, and how users react to the required PLUGINs, and their long
download times.
